Solar-Powered Water Treatment 01.10.2023 48:08
Wastewater treatment plants serve approximately 75% of Americans—more than 248 million people. However, many people do not recognize the energy burden these facilities create, which can be more than 30% of a municipality's energy bill. Most of this energy comes from fossil fuels. Urban embodied carbon 01.06.2023 11:25
Every material that makes up a building, be it steel, concrete, wood, or plastic, has a greenhouse gas emission associated with it. This is called embodied carbon, and calculating the amount of GHG for one building is achievable. However, calculating that number for an entire city is still a challenge. Cities cooled by trees 01.05.2023 23:37
As cities are built, a lot of vegetation is replaced with building materials such as concrete and brick. These materials absorb the sun's heat and then radiate it back into the atmosphere. This leads to urban heat islands where cities are much hotter than the surrounding areas. But trees offer shade and cooling, reducing the temperature in cities. Battery energy from waste heat 01.03.2023 18:34
Waste heat has been a challenge that scientists and engineers have been pondering for decades. What can be done with this lost energy and can it be harnessed in a useful way? As combustion and technology improved, the percentage of waste heat has decreased, but it is estimated that up to 50% of all industrial energy is lost through waste heat.
